/* #PRODUIRE{fond=css/root.css}
   md5:b727834fc170826100451d674616df28 */
:root { --primary-c: 0;
--secondary-c: 0;
--tertiary-c: 0;
--bg-c: 0;
--text-c: 0;
 }
.bg-primary {
 --bg-h: var(--primary-h);
--bg-s: var(--primary-s);
--bg-l: var(--primary-l);
--bg-a: var(--primary-a);
--bg-c: var(--primary-c, 0);
--bg-lc: max(0, min(calc(var(--bg-l) + var(--bg-c, 1)), 100));
background-color: hsla(var(--bg-h), calc(var(--bg-s) * 1%), calc(var(--bg-lc) * 1%), var(--bg-a)) !important;
 }
.bg-secondary {
 --bg-h: var(--secondary-h);
--bg-s: var(--secondary-s);
--bg-l: var(--secondary-l);
--bg-a: var(--secondary-a);
--bg-c: var(--secondary-c, 0);
--bg-lc: max(0, min(calc(var(--bg-l) + var(--bg-c, 1)), 100));
background-color: hsla(var(--bg-h), calc(var(--bg-s) * 1%), calc(var(--bg-lc) * 1%), var(--bg-a)) !important;
 }
.bg-tertiary {
 --bg-h: var(--tertiary-h);
--bg-s: var(--tertiary-s);
--bg-l: var(--tertiary-l);
--bg-a: var(--tertiary-a);
--bg-c: var(--tertiary-c, 0);
--bg-lc: max(0, min(calc(var(--bg-l) + var(--bg-c, 1)), 100));
background-color: hsla(var(--bg-h), calc(var(--bg-s) * 1%), calc(var(--bg-lc) * 1%), var(--bg-a)) !important;
 }
.bg-lightest { --bg-c: 30; }
.bg-lighter { --bg-c: 20; }
.bg-light { --bg-c: 10; }
.bg-dark { --bg-c: -10; }
.bg-darker { --bg-c: -20; }
.bg-darkest { --bg-c: -30; }
.text-primary {
 --text-h: var(--primary-h);
--text-s: var(--primary-s);
--text-l: var(--primary-l);
--text-a: var(--primary-a);
--text-c: var(--primary-c, 0);
--text-lc: max(0, min(calc(var(--text-l) + var(--text-c, 1)), 100));
color: hsla(var(--text-h), calc(var(--text-s) * 1%), calc(var(--text-lc) * 1%), var(--text-a)) !important;
 }
.text-secondary {
 --text-h: var(--secondary-h);
--text-s: var(--secondary-s);
--text-l: var(--secondary-l);
--text-a: var(--secondary-a);
--text-c: var(--secondary-c, 0);
--text-lc: max(0, min(calc(var(--text-l) + var(--text-c, 1)), 100));
color: hsla(var(--text-h), calc(var(--text-s) * 1%), calc(var(--text-lc) * 1%), var(--text-a)) !important;
 }
.text-tertiary {
 --text-h: var(--tertiary-h);
--text-s: var(--tertiary-s);
--text-l: var(--tertiary-l);
--text-a: var(--tertiary-a);
--text-c: var(--tertiary-c, 0);
--text-lc: max(0, min(calc(var(--text-l) + var(--text-c, 1)), 100));
color: hsla(var(--text-h), calc(var(--text-s) * 1%), calc(var(--text-lc) * 1%), var(--text-a)) !important;
 }
.text-lightest { --text-c: 30; }
.text-lighter { --text-c: 20; }
.text-light { --text-c: 10; }
.text-dark { --text-c: -10; }
.text-darker { --text-c: -20; }
.text-darkest { --text-c: -30; }
:root {
 --primary-h: 243;
--primary-s: 65;
--primary-l: 46;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 197;
--secondary-s: 63;
--secondary-l: 60;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 260;
--tertiary-s: 100;
--tertiary-l: 50;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-cafe {
 --primary-h: 36;
--primary-s: 37;
--primary-l: 35;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 34;
--secondary-s: 17;
--secondary-l: 69;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 79;
--tertiary-s: 65;
--tertiary-l: 43;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-carmin {
 --primary-h: 5;
--primary-s: 68;
--primary-l: 42;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 37;
--secondary-s: 44;
--secondary-l: 77;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 350;
--tertiary-s: 15;
--tertiary-l: 68;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-citron {
 --primary-h: 32;
--primary-s: 100;
--primary-l: 46;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 51;
--secondary-s: 72;
--secondary-l: 73;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 217;
--tertiary-s: 4;
--tertiary-l: 61;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-foret {
 --primary-h: 76;
--primary-s: 61;
--primary-l: 38;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 68;
--secondary-s: 20;
--secondary-l: 71;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 47;
--tertiary-s: 21;
--tertiary-l: 45;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-framboise {
 --primary-h: 337;
--primary-s: 77;
--primary-l: 47;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 302;
--secondary-s: 40;
--secondary-l: 74;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 75;
--tertiary-s: 2;
--tertiary-l: 69;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-ocean {
 --primary-h: 203;
--primary-s: 65;
--primary-l: 49;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 211;
--secondary-s: 43;
--secondary-l: 69;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 184;
--tertiary-s: 83;
--tertiary-l: 36;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
.theme-custom {
 --primary-h: 243;
--primary-s: 65;
--primary-l: 46;
--primary-a: 1;
--primary-lc: max(0, min(calc(var(--primary-l) + var(--primary-c, 1)), 100));
--secondary-h: 197;
--secondary-s: 63;
--secondary-l: 60;
--secondary-a: 1;
--secondary-lc: max(0, min(calc(var(--secondary-l) + var(--secondary-c, 1)), 100));
--tertiary-h: 260;
--tertiary-s: 100;
--tertiary-l: 50;
--tertiary-a: 1;
--tertiary-lc: max(0, min(calc(var(--tertiary-l) + var(--tertiary-c, 1)), 100));
--font-family: Lato;
--line-height: 1.5;
 }
